Holly’s Inbox is completely written in emails between Holly and her friends and it is downright hilarious the trouble that Holly can manage to get herself into.  Here’s a quote from my review in 2009:

‘Holly’s Inbox by Holly Denham (a.k.a. Bill Surie) has got to be the most fun I’ve had reading a book in a while. Have you ever closed the last page of a novel and wanted to open it back up right away and start over? That’s exactly how I felt about Holly’s Inbox! It is done in the manner of Bridget Jone’s Diary which I also loved – I think I just really like getting in on a person’s inner most goings on and being snoopy.’

About Holly’s Inbox by Holly Denham (Bill Surie)

Meet Holly Denham. It’s her first day as a receptionist at a City investment bank and, with no corporate front-of-house experience, Holly is struggling to keep up. Add to this her mad friends, dysfunctional family and gossipy colleagues, and Holly’s inbox is a daily source of drama, laughter, scandal and even romance. But Holly’s been keeping a secret from everyone – and the past is about to catch up with her…
